Essay: Analyzing Arguments

This assignment challenges you to analyze how two writers present arguments about a significant issue/topic. For this assignment, you will choose a current newspaper or scholarly journal article that focuses on a current issue relevant to the people on the continent of Africa, and/or people of African descent. Your goal is to identify the purposes and claims of each author, locate their arguments in a rhetorical situation, and analyze the appeals each writer makes to support their argument. You will then evaluate the arguments: which author better satisfies their readers? Which author crafts the more fitting response? Choose your issue/topic carefully, as you may want to make an informed argument about the same issue/topic for the next essay.

In sum, then, the main goals are:
1.    Identify the purposes and claims that two authors make about a significant issue.

2.    Locate the arguments in a rhetorical situation (what is the exigence the authors address? What constraints and resources exist for the authors? To whom are they writing? When and where was the article published?

3.    Analyze the appeals (logical, ethical, emotional) put forth by the writers.

4.    Evaluate the arguments. Which argument is more fitting? Which author better satisfies readers? (Your evaluation need not be either/or: maybe one author is more effective logically, for instance, while the second author is more effective ethically and emotionally.)

This paper must be at least 5 1/2 – 6 pages in length, and you need to appropriately cite your two sources in MLA style.
